What to look for

Temperature Stability

Look for machines with PID control to ensure water stays at the perfect brewing temperature.

Boiler System Type

A breville dual boiler espresso machine setup allows for simultaneous brewing and steaming.

Grinder Integration

Built-in grinders save counter space and provide fresh grounds for every single shot.

Steam Wand Quality

A high-pressure steam wand is essential for creating silky microfoam for lattes.

Portafilter Size

Industry-standard 58mm portafilters offer better heat retention and more consistent extraction results.

Ease of Cleaning

Choose models with removable drip trays and accessible water tanks for effortless daily maintenance.

Coffee & Bakeware — FAQ

What is a dual boiler system?

A dual boiler system uses two separate heaters for brewing and steaming. This allows you to perform both tasks simultaneously without waiting for the machine to change temperatures.

Why is a 58mm portafilter preferred?

The 58mm size is the professional standard used in commercial cafes. It provides a larger surface area for water to pass through, resulting in more even extraction.

Do I need a built-in grinder?

It depends on your space and budget. A built-in grinder is convenient, but a standalone burr grinder often offers more control over grind consistency.

How often should I descale?

You should descale your machine every 2 to 3 months depending on your water hardness. Regular descaling prevents mineral buildup that can damage internal components.

Is PID control necessary?

Yes, PID control is crucial for consistent espresso. It regulates the water temperature to prevent it from swinging too high or low during the extraction process.

Can I use pre-ground coffee?

While you can, it is not recommended for high-end machines. Freshly ground beans provide significantly better flavor and crema than pre-ground options.
